ETYMOLOGY OF THE WORD BOURDON

From Old French: drone (of a musical instrument), of imitative origin.

WHAT DOES BOURDON M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Bourdon

Bourdon derives from the French for bumblebee, and may refer to: ▪ A Bourdon, the lowest bell in a set ▪ A Bourdon, a stopped organ pipe of a construction favored for low pitches ▪ Bourdon ▪ Burden: The lowest course of a lute, or the lowest drone pipe of a bagpipe ▪ Faux bourdon, fauxbourdon, faburden or falsobordone, terms applied to a variety of music compositional techniques ▪ Bourdon, Somme, a small town in France ▪ Bourdon, another name for the French wine grape Douce noir ▪ A Bourdon gauge or Bourdon tube, named after Eugène Bourdon...

Definition of bourdon in the English dictionary

The first definition of bourdon in the dictionary is a 16-foot organ stop of the stopped diapason type. Other definition of bourdon is the drone of a bagpipe. Bourdon is also a drone or pedal point in the bass of a harmonized melody.
